{"id":142391,"date":"2025-09-14T10:50:13","date_gmt":"2025-09-14T10:50:13","guid":{"rendered":"https:\/\/www.newsbeep.com\/au\/142391\/"},"modified":"2025-09-14T10:50:13","modified_gmt":"2025-09-14T10:50:13","slug":"relationship-between-a-programmer-and-ai-will-become-a-team-effort","status":"publish","type":"post","link":"https:\/\/www.newsbeep.com\/au\/142391\/","title":{"rendered":"Relationship between a programmer and AI will become a team effort"},"content":{"rendered":"<p>Breadcrumb Trail Links<\/p>\n<p><a class=\"breadcrumbs__item-link\" data-tb-category-link=\"\" href=\"http:\/\/www.brantfordexpositor.ca\/category\/opinion\/columnists\/\" rel=\"nofollow noopener\" target=\"_blank\">Column<\/a><\/p>\n<p class=\"article-subtitle\">Instead of taking over, AI is acting as a helpful assistant, making the job of a programmer faster and easier.<\/p>\n<p>Author of the article:<\/p>\n<p> <a href=\"https:\/\/brantfordexpositor.ca\/author\/tim-philip-for-the-expositor\/\" rel=\"nofollow noopener\" target=\"_blank\">Tim Philp<\/a>  \u00a0\u2022\u00a0  For the Expositor<\/p>\n<p>Published Sep 12, 2025 \u00a0\u2022\u00a0 Last updated 1\u00a0day ago \u00a0\u2022\u00a0 3 minute read<\/p>\n<p><img alt=\"artificial intelligence graphic\" class=\"featured-image__image type:primaryImage\" src=\"https:\/\/www.newsbeep.com\/au\/wp-content\/uploads\/2025\/09\/gettyimages-2219007409-170667a-e1755183048563.jpg\"  decoding=\"async\" fetchpriority=\"high\" height=\"295\" width=\"393\"\/>  Getty ImagesArticle content<\/p>\n<p>I have recently been working on a database programming application and have, for the first time, used artificial intelligence (AI) to help with the programming.<\/p>\n<p>Advertisement 2<\/p>\n<p>This advertisement has not loaded yet, but your article continues below.<\/p>\n<p>Article content<\/p>\n<p>If my experience is any judge, the world of computing is about to undergo a sea-change in the way our programs are created.<\/p>\n<p>Article content<\/p>\n<p>Recommended Videos<\/p>\n<p>Article content<\/p>\n<p>Instead of taking over, AI is acting as a helpful assistant, making the job of a programmer faster and easier.<\/p>\n<p>Think of it like a smart co-pilot that can watch what a programmer is doing and then suggest the next line of code or even write whole parts of a program based on a simple instruction.<\/p>\n<p>For example, a programmer can type a sentence like \u201ccreate a button that saves user information,\u201d and the AI can instantly write the code needed to do just that. This is a massive change from the old way of doing things, where every single line of code had to be written by hand.<\/p>\n<p>The benefits for programmers are huge. For one, AI dramatically speeds up the process by taking over the boring, repetitive tasks. This is like having a robot build the basic frame of a house while the builder focuses on the more important parts, like the unique design and interior layout. This frees up the programmer\u2019s time to focus on the more interesting and challenging parts of their job, such as creating new features or solving complex problems.<\/p>\n<p>Advertisement 3<\/p>\n<p>This advertisement has not loaded yet, but your article continues below.<\/p>\n<p>Article content<\/p>\n<p>AI also helps catch mistakes. It can quickly scan through code and find errors or security weaknesses that a human might miss.<\/p>\n<p>For those just starting out in programming, AI can be a great teacher, offering suggestions and examples that help them learn much faster. In essence, it makes creating software more accessible to more people.<\/p>\n<p>AI is even good at analysing code or the output of a program for errors. Should a bug appear in the program, sometimes describing the bug, or showing the output of the faulty code is enough to allow the AI to find the problem and fix it.<\/p>\n<p>In the experience that I have had working with AI as a programming tool; it is capable of finding extremely subtle errors in the code that might have taken days for me to find. This promises to speed up the development of computer programs tremendously.<\/p>\n<p>Advertisement 4<\/p>\n<p>This advertisement has not loaded yet, but your article continues below.<\/p>\n<p>Article content<\/p>\n<p>As AI becomes more advanced, the future of programming will look different. The job of a programmer won\u2019t be about writing every line of code from scratch. Instead, they will become more like a director, telling the AI what they want the program to do.<\/p>\n<p>Their focus will shift from the small details of code to the big picture \u2014 designing how a program works and what it should accomplish. This is already happening with \u201cno-code\u201d and \u201clow-code\u201d platforms, where people can build applications by dragging and dropping elements instead of writing code.<\/p>\n<p>Even with all this AI help, the human programmer remains vital. AI can\u2019t invent new ideas, understand complex business goals, or make ethical judgments on its own\u2026 at least, not yet. It\u2019s up to the programmer to check the AI\u2019s work, make sure the program is secure, and guide the AI to solve problems in new and creative ways.<\/p>\n<p>The relationship between a programmer and AI will become a team effort, where the AI handles the routine tasks and the human provides the creativity, strategy, and critical thinking.<\/p>\n<p>The future of programming isn\u2019t about people being replaced, but about being empowered to do more and achieve their goals faster.<\/p>\n<p>Tim Philp has enjoyed science since he was old enough to read. Having worked in technical fields all his life, he shares his love of science with readers. He can be reached by e-mail at tphilp@bfree.on.ca<\/p>\n<p>Article content<\/p>\n<p>Share this article in your social network<\/p>\n","protected":false},"excerpt":{"rendered":"Breadcrumb Trail Links Column Instead of taking over, AI is acting as a helpful assistant, making the job&hellip;\n","protected":false},"author":2,"featured_media":142392,"comment_status":"","ping_status":"","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[21],"tags":[64,63,257,105],"class_list":{"0":"post-142391","1":"post","2":"type-post","3":"status-publish","4":"format-standard","5":"has-post-thumbnail","7":"category-computing","8":"tag-au","9":"tag-australia","10":"tag-computing","11":"tag-technology"},"_links":{"self":[{"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/posts\/142391","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/comments?post=142391"}],"version-history":[{"count":0,"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/posts\/142391\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/media\/142392"}],"wp:attachment":[{"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/media?parent=142391"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/categories?post=142391"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.newsbeep.com\/au\/wp-json\/wp\/v2\/tags?post=142391"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}